Tate Doubles Through Theuma; Hansen Out
Level 12
: Blinds 2,000/4,000, 6,000 ante
Corel Theuma opened from middle position and was called by Felipe Ramos in the hijack. Brian Tate then shoved for 53,500 from the cutoff, which got a call from Theum and a a fold from Ramos.
Theuma stood pat and Tate drew one.
Brian Tate: Jx10x8x5x3x
Corel Theuma: 9x5x4x3x
Theuma drew a 4x — pairing his four to award Tate the double up.
"I folded a better jack," Ramos added as Theuma collected the pot.
At another table, Gus Hansen, who max late-regged, was eliminated.
